So this was my first attempt at recreating this for my wife. Not there yet but she thinks it is close and she likes it.

I have lurked for awhile and gotten great ideas thought I would finally share.

2 Nopales leaves
7 Jalapeños roasted and seeded
2 Serranos roasted
1 White Onion raw
5 Garlic cloves raw
Knorr chicken bouillon to taste
Salt
Olive Oil to thicken

Next time going to get some Crema to replace the olive oil just did not have any right now and as more Serranos.

    Ingredients are off to a good start, but I’d assume they’re not using a bouillon cube in their salsa.

    You’re probably missing some acidity, like lime juice. I’d try adding some to taste and see if that helps.

    I’d also try adding in some cilantro, or tomatillos which are commonly used in salsa verde. But judging by how the restaurants look, it’s definitely a bit thicker, so the tomatillos may make it a bit more watery if you use too much.

    Could even experiment with avocado for a creamier texture.
